4 hours ago, Captain Powerhouse said:
Tossing this here for consideration, this MIGHT go to test in a future time, but wanted to hear some feedback before even going there:
Super Strength > Rage:
- Activating Rage while the buff is still up will no longer add a second stack, instead it will increase the duration of the current buff by an additional 120 seconds.
- Example: Use rage when there are 30 seconds left, rage it will now last for 150 seconds.
- No longer has a crash of any kind. No endurance crash, no defense crash, no -dmg crash, nothing. Letting rage expire and continue to attack without using it again would be it's own penalty.
I think this would be a swift kick below the belt for most people that play SS.. If built right, the CD on Rage would be under 60 sec so that you could have 3 copies up which is a constant overlapping double stack. Building around the 160% damage buff for 110 seconds by the 10 second penalty is perfectly acceptable given the extra 110 seconds of 150% badassness you get over every other powerset. Its just a trade off you have to calculate for similarly to the way you would for Unstoppable or MoG Crashes. The -20% can be offset with 2 purps.. the -1000% dmg you wait for, the end crash is erased with Ageless or Blues. It seems like a fair counter to what makes it great honestly.
